TL;DR Summary

Manhattan DA Alvin Bragg has requested a limited gag order on former President Donald Trump in his hush money case, citing Trump's history of attacking adversaries and the surge in threats against the DA and his office. Prosecutors seek to restrict prejudicial extrajudicial statements by Trump and bar him from making public remarks about witnesses, jurors, and court staff. The trial is set to begin on March 25, and Trump has pleaded not guilty to 34 counts in the case.
